From: David Bremner Date: Tue, 20 Mar 2012 11:08:17 +0000 (-0300) Subject: Merge tag '0.12' X-Git-Tag: 0.13_rc1~126 X-Git-Url: https://git.cworth.org/git?p=notmuch;a=commitdiff_plain;h=596a2076dcc1ebec2dc217f6d967397ef125aac4;hp=-c Merge tag '0.12' notmuch 0.12 release --- 596a2076dcc1ebec2dc217f6d967397ef125aac4 diff --combined NEWS index 631cf1d5,2e393c4b..ed5e3c5a --- a/NEWS +++ b/NEWS @@@ -1,57 -1,3 +1,57 @@@ +Notmuch 0.13 (2012-xx-xx) +========================= + +Command-Line Interface +---------------------- + +Reply to sender + + "notmuch reply" has gained the ability to create a reply template + for replying just to the sender of the message, in addition to reply + to all. The feature is available through the new command line option + --reply-to=(all|sender). + +JSON reply format + + "notmuch reply" can now produce JSON output that contains the headers + for a reply message and full information about the original message + begin replied to. This allows MUAs to create replies intelligtently. + For example, an MUA that can parse HTML might quote HTML parts. + + Calling notmuch reply with --format=json imposes the restriction that + only a single message is returned by the search, as replying to + multiple messages does not have a well-defined behavior. The default + retains its current behavior for multiple message replies. + +Tag exclusion + + Tags can be automatically excluded from search results by adding them + to the new 'search.exclude_tags' option in the Notmuch config file. + + This behaviour can be overridden by explicitly including an excluded + tag in your query, for example: + + notmuch search $your_query and tag:$excluded_tag + + Existing users will probably want to run "notmuch setup" again to add + the new well-commented [search] section to the configuration file. + + For new configurations, accepting the default setting will cause the + tags "deleted" and "spam" to be excluded, equivalent to running: + + notmuch config set search.exclude_tags deleted spam + +Emacs Interface +--------------- + +Reply improvement using the JSON format + + Emacs now uses the JSON reply format to create replies. It obeys + the customization variables message-citation-line-format and + message-citation-line-function when creating the first line of the + reply body, and it will quote HTML parts if no text/plain parts are + available. + Notmuch 0.12 (2012-03-20) ========================= @@@ -167,6 -113,11 +167,11 @@@ Enable `notmuch-search-line-faces' by d for new users by showing "unread" messages bold and "flagged" messages blue by default in the search view. + Printing Support + + notmuch-show mode now has simple printing support, bound to '#' by + default. You can customize the variable notmuch-print-mechanism. + Library changes ---------------